I mainly use the Amazon Marketplace (UK and FR). Price plus postage (£1.82 on amazon UK, 3.40€ on Amazon FR)is usually cheaper than buying from Amazon directly (with free shipping).

In that case, discs are shipped individually, and the package fits into my letterbox. Some sellers ship from the US, so it can take a while though (2-3 weeks). As the value of the shipment is below 22€, no customs duties / VAT are due.
